Fabrice, All,

On 2019-09-29 20:04 +0200, Fabrice Fontaine spake thusly:
> procps support has been removed since version 10.2.5 and
> https://github.com/vmware/open-vm-tools/commit/ed2e2348dd6af823f9458c5959c89acf2f13a952
> 
> Signed-off-by: Fabrice Fontaine <fontaine.fabrice@gmail.com>

Applied to master, thanks, with a small nit...
